Interaction free energy between plates with charge regulation: A linearized model

SL Carnie, DYC Chan

Journal of Colloid and Interface Science | ACADEMIC PRESS INC JNL-COMP SUBSCRIPTIONS | Published : 1993

Abstract

The linearized Poisson-Boltzmann theory is used to calculate the electrical double layer interaction free energy between two parallel charged plates for the case in which charge regulation due to the dissociation of surface groups may be modelled by the linearized regulation model that specifies a linear relationship between the surface charge and the surface potential. This charge regulation model is characterized by a constant—termed the regulation capacitance of the surface. Analytic expressions for the force per unit area, the interaction free energy per unit area as well as the interaction free energy between two nonidentical spheres in the Deryaguin limit are given for the general case..
